    Bills Defense currently 5th in Sacks. 14th against the run.

    3 weeks into the season improvements to the defensive line are already starting to bear fruit. One of the question marks going into the Browns game is whether the Bills defense could stop Trent Richardson. After holding him to a very humbling 27 yards on 12 carries, a 2.2 yard per carry average, I think they answered that question in a big way. The Bills overall held the Browns to just 33 yards rushing, vaulting them from the bottom half of the league against the run to 14th overall.

    They have been phenomenal in the sacks department. This team doesn't blitz much, in fact I don't remember an instance where the Bills have even sent a blitz package against a team this year. Of course you could say that the Kelvin Sheppard sack against the Chiefs may be an instance of that. But the point being, with a team that doesn't put many blitz packages together, the Bills are doing a very good job of getting to the QB, and is a testament to the improvement of the defensive front. Currently ranked 5th in the NFL with 9 sacks through 3 games, only the Bears, Cardinals, Bengals, and Packers are better through the first 3 games. That's pretty good company to be in, and a big improvement from last year at this time with 2 sacks through the first 3 games for the Bills in 2011 when they went 3-0.

            The problem with signing a defensive front-seven player for a huge amount of money is that he instantly becomes a target. While that can be used very effectively to free up other, less glamorous players, it reflects very poorly on the high-budget player's stats. We saw that last year with Shawne Merriman when he was healthy-- a disruptive force, yes, but not a lot of statistics because he was always being double-teamed. When he went down, his absence was felt.
